Early Victorian Mahogany Candle Riser In The Form Of A Games Table

About the Item

With tilt top with checkerboard inlay on a turned support and tripartite base and bun feet.

  • Large Victorian Games Compendium in Hardwood Jointed Box with Many Games
    Located in Lincoln, Lincolnshire
    This is a high quality large Games Compendium, complete with many individual games in its original hardwood storage box with a hinged lid. All the pieces are well made and complete. The box is very well made of a jointed hardwood, possibly red walnut and is a high quality piece in its own right. The box has developed a lovely color and patination from use and wear. The exterior has a brass oval inset into its top, a brass twin lever lock and brass hinges. The interior is sectioned into different sub compartments by hardwood dividers. Many different games are included within the compendium, including; 55 piece 9 - spot dominoes Chess set - Very good high quality set, large pieces( Kings 8.7 cm high) and glass eyes to Knights, Draughts with 24 x turned hardwood pieces Backgammon with 30 x turned hardwood counters 2 sets of playing cards and two Bezique marker boards Hardwood turned dice shaker and various different dice tiddlywinks Pick up sticks...
